Arvo Pärt and the Art of Embodiment

View through CrossRef
Chapter 1, written by the book’s three co-editors, serves as the book’s introduction. It sets out the book’s genesis, its interest in sound studies, and its main themes—chiefly surrounding the function that music plays in the embodiment of ideas, dispositions, and spirituality. More specifically, it points out how several chapters of this book entail a rethinking of Arvo Pärt’s compositional odyssey, grounding (or again, embodying) it in history and in his context as an Eastern European composer of the 1960s. It also summarizes all the book’s chapters, in the manner of a typical introduction to an edited volume.
